"accidental colour" meaning in All languages combined

See accidental colour on Wiktionary

Noun [English]

Forms: accidental colours [plural]
Head templates: {{en-noun}} accidental colour (plural accidental colours)
  1. (optics) A colour depending on the hypersensibility of the retina of the eye for complementary colours. They are purely subjective sensations of colour which often result from the contemplation of actually coloured bodies. Categories (topical): Optics
